I just noticed today that my 2.5 year old eastern painted has slightly cloudy eyes. Not really bad, but they are not clear like normal. The setup is a plastic tub with basking spot and uvb. Water temp is 70-72. Her diet is mostly mazuri and sera pellets, occasional bloodworms. Weekly water changes and good filtration.

I looked it up a bit and found vitamin a deficiency and bacterial infection as potential issues. Vet is an option if need be, but there is a lot to be desired in terms of qualified herp vets around here. Any ideas? Thanks
 
I'd recommend picking up some Zoomed Turtle Eye Drops. They do a really good job at clearing up the problem plus it has vitamin A in it. Does your turtle eat veggies? You could try adding grated carrot, yellow squash and zucchini to it's diet. All are loaded with vitamin A.
